Campion & Immaculate retain titles at Mayberry Investment High School Swimming Championship

Campion College and Immaculate have both retained their respective titles at the Mayberry Investments Limited High School Swimming Championships at the National Aquatic Centre.

Campion took the boys’ title after amassing 580 points to finish ahead of Wolmer’s who were second on 483.

Kingston College (256), Jamaica College (162) and American International High (38) round out the top 5.

Immaculate meanwhile piled up 645 points to take top spot among the girls’.

Campion (404) and St. Andrew High (310) finished second and third respectively with Wolmer’s Girls third on 108 and Mobay High 5th on 62.

A total of sixteen (16) records were broken on the day with fourteen (14) being individual records and two (2) being relay records.

Pride of place goes to Zaneta Alvaranga of Immaculate and Nathaniel Thomas of Campion with both swimmers breaking three individual records.

Alvaranga in addition to records in the 50m Freestyle, 50m Breaststroke and 50m Butterfly, won the High Point Trophy for scoring the most points in her age group and joined forces with Imani Salmon, Brook Hopkins and Safiya Officer to place her name another time in the record books.

Thomas records came in the 50m Freestyle, 200m Individual Medley and the 50m Butterfly. The 14 year old also won the High Point Trophy for the 13-14 Boys age group.

The two (2) relay records belong to Immaculate in the 13-14 and 15-16 Girls Medley Relays

Other record breakers are:

Kokolo Foster of Immaculate with two

Britney Williams of Wolmers Girls with two

Brianna Anderson of Immaculate with one

Kyle Sinclair of Wolmers Boys with one

Sabrina Lyn of Campion with one

Chester Adams of Jamaica College with one

The event is the final long course meet ahead of the CARIFTA Swimming Championships to be held in Barbados from April 20-23.
